How much do patient services man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for patient services manager in the United States is $66,085.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51,000.00 and $79,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Patient Services Manager do?

A Patient Services Manager is responsible for overseeing the administrative and operational aspects of patient care within a healthcare facility. They coordinate schedules, manage patient admissions and discharges, and ensure that patients receive quality service throughout their stay or visit. Additionally, they supervise staff, address patient concerns, and work to improve the overall patient experience. Their role is essential in maintaining efficient and patient-centered healthcare delivery.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Patient Services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Patient Services Manager, you need a background in healthcare administration or a related field, often supported by a bachelor’s degree and experience in patient services or management. Familiarity with hospital information systems, scheduling software, and compliance standards such as HIPAA is typ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and interpersonal communication skills help manage staff and ensure positive patient experiences. These abilities are crucial to coordinate efficient patient care operations, enhance service quality, and maintain regulatory compliance in healthcare settings.

In this role, you will support the successful operation of the Food & Nutrition Services Department by overseeing patient meal service, ensuring patient satisfaction, and assisting with daily foodservice operations. You will play a key role in maintaining quality standards, supporting tray assembly and delivery processes, resolving patient concerns, and collaborating closely with nursing staff and team members to ensure an exceptional dining experience for patients and residents.

Job Summary

We are seeking a Patient Services Manager to lead our Patient Services Team in an Acute Care setting in City, State.   

Key Responsibilities:

  • Establishes goals and oversees implementation of patient food services needs based upon medical direction and patient population
  • Hires, directs, coaches, trains, and develops patient service team members
  • Complies with dietary restrictions on special or modified diets to ensure optimal food preferences are met within guidelines of the diet order limitations
  • Ensures patient services staff assists in achieving stated patient satisfaction goals
  • Complies with regulatory standards, including federal, state, and accrediting agencies while adhering to facility confidentiality, HIPAA regulations, and patient rights policies
  • Participates in/ leads patient satisfaction programs, departmental meetings, and facility wide Quality Assurance/Performance Improvement programs

 
Qualifications:

  • Associate degree with one (1) year work experience in food services or related field, or bachelor's degree in food service technology/management or related field
  • Certified Dietary Manager certificate, Registered Diet Technician or Registered Dietitian, preferred
  • Minimum of one (1) year experience in food service management preferred in an acute care setting
  • ServSafe certified, desirable
  • Possess the necessary skills to effectively utilize Microsoft office applications, electronic medical record, and diet office systems
